[Switzerland](/switzerland "13 Cannabis Social Clubs in Switzerland (2026) | Cannabivo")’s five-year St. Gallen cannabis pilot, designed for up to 5,000 adults, provides the local policy context for a separate US development: Sen. John Fetterman is urging the US Congress to “stop dicking around” and legalize marijuana while backing a bill that would remove cannabis from the US Controlled Substances Act.

## Fetterman backs a federal move beyond rescheduling

US Sen. John Fetterman, a Pennsylvania Democrat, renewed his call for federal marijuana legalization on July 21, 2026. In its [report on Fetterman’s legalization call](https://www.marijuanamoment.net/congress-should-stop-dicking-around-and-legalize-marijuana-fetterman-says/ "report on Fetterman’s legalization call"), Marijuana Moment said the senator was promoting his support for the recently filed Cannabis Administration and Opportunity Act, or CAOA.

Fetterman said he had always been “very pro-weed” and described his position as rooted in a libertarian view that people should not be judged or punished for using cannabis. He argued that a path to wellness should be “legal, safe, and regulated,” rather than governed by criminal penalties.

The senator has supported administrative steps taken by both US President Joe Biden and US President Donald Trump, including the federal rescheduling process. He also cited the mass cannabis pardons issued by Biden. His latest message is that those steps do not replace an act of the US Congress ending federal prohibition.

## Switzerland’s St. Gallen experiment offers a different model

Switzerland’s own policy development is taking place through a controlled research model rather than the federal legislative proposal Fetterman is advocating in the United States. The St. Gallen project, planned for autumn 2026, is a **five-year pilot** examining the social, economic and health effects of regulated cannabis access for adults.

The Swiss project is expected to involve up to **5,000 adults**. About 3,300 participants are expected to be eligible to purchase cannabis legally, with access through specialist stores, pharmacies or home delivery. Some participants will receive products by post after online consultations, making St. Gallen the only Swiss pilot described in the supplied research to test postal delivery.

The study is being conducted with the University of Zurich and ETH Zurich’s KOF Institute. A [report on Switzerland’s St. Gallen postal-delivery pilot](https://www.mmjdaily.com/article/9855278/st-gallen-becomes-the-only-swiss-cannabis-pilot-to-test-delivery-by-post/ "report on Switzerland’s St. Gallen postal-delivery pilot") describes the project as an effort to compare distribution channels and examine whether regulated access can displace the illicit market.

## Descheduling and rescheduling would produce different outcomes

The central distinction in the US debate is between **descheduling** and rescheduling. The CAOA would remove cannabis entirely from the US Controlled Substances Act. The separate proposal being considered by the US Drug Enforcement Administration would move marijuana from Schedule I to Schedule III instead.

The Swiss pilot operates on another level again. It is a time-limited research project examining regulated access and delivery methods in one Swiss setting. It is not described in the supplied facts as a nationwide change to Switzerland’s cannabis law.

## The CAOA links legalization with criminal-justice measures

Fetterman’s support is not limited to removing cannabis from the federal schedules. The Cannabis Administration and Opportunity Act would also create measures aimed at people who were affected by prohibition and at communities harmed by the US criminal-justice system.

The proposal’s main elements, as described in the source report, include:

- Removing cannabis from the US Controlled Substances Act through descheduling.
- Creating a pathway to reduce and expunge prior criminal sentences for cannabis offenses.
- Restoring access to housing, employment and civil rights that people may have lost because of cannabis convictions.
- Applying a federal tax to marijuana.
- Using part of that tax revenue to create a Cannabis Justice Office within the US Department of Justice.
- Directing the office to manage a fund supporting job training, reentry and legal aid for people from communities harmed by prohibition.

The proposal goes beyond legal status

The CAOA combines federal descheduling with sentence relief, expungement, restored rights and a justice fund. Its stated approach therefore covers both the legal status of cannabis and the consequences of past prohibition.

## Why rescheduling has not satisfied Fetterman

### An administrative process versus an act of Congress

The CAOA was introduced one day after testimony concluded in a US Drug Enforcement Administration hearing on the proposal to move marijuana from Schedule I to Schedule III. That rescheduling process began during the Biden administration and continued under the Trump administration.

Rescheduling would not be the same as removing cannabis from the Controlled Substances Act. Fetterman’s argument is that the federal government has already taken several steps, but that Congress still has to address the underlying prohibition directly.

In May, Fetterman gave Trump cross-party credit for advancing marijuana rescheduling and accelerating therapeutic access to psychedelics. He also said that his support for legal marijuana and psychedelics had remained consistent even when those positions were politically unpopular.

That distinction matters for the Swiss comparison. St. Gallen is testing how regulated access might work in a defined population and through different channels. Fetterman is backing a proposal that would change federal legal status across the United States and add a national framework for taxation and justice measures.

## What the Swiss and US developments do—and do not—share

The two developments share a focus on moving away from blanket prohibition, but the supplied facts do not describe them as connected policies. Switzerland’s St. Gallen project is designed to generate evidence about regulated sales, delivery and market displacement. The US CAOA is a federal legislative proposal that would remove cannabis from the country’s controlled-substances framework.

Key questions about the two approaches

Has the US Congress legalized marijuana?The supplied facts describe a newly filed bill and Fetterman’s call for Congress to act. They do not report that the bill has passed or that federal prohibition has ended.

What does descheduling mean in the CAOA?Descheduling would remove cannabis completely from the US Controlled Substances Act.

How is descheduling different from rescheduling?Rescheduling would move marijuana from Schedule I to Schedule III under the US Controlled Substances Act. Descheduling would remove it from that law altogether.

What is Switzerland testing in St. Gallen?The five-year Swiss pilot is studying regulated cannabis access for up to 5,000 adults, including distribution through specialist stores, pharmacies and home delivery by post.

Does the US bill change Swiss law?No direct change to Swiss law is described. The St. Gallen pilot and the US federal bill are separate developments in separate jurisdictions.

## A Swiss pilot and a US federal demand remain separate tracks

For readers in Switzerland, the immediate local development is the St. Gallen study: a defined, five-year test of regulated access and postal delivery. Fetterman’s remarks concern the United States, where he is pressing Congress to replace incremental federal changes with full descheduling and a broader justice framework.

The main points

- US Sen. John Fetterman has urged Congress to stop delaying federal marijuana legalization.
- He supports the Cannabis Administration and Opportunity Act, which would remove cannabis from the US Controlled Substances Act.
- The proposed US legislation also covers sentence reduction, expungement, restored rights, taxation and a Cannabis Justice Office.
- Switzerland’s St. Gallen pilot is a separate five-year research project for up to 5,000 adults, with about 3,300 expected to be eligible to purchase cannabis.

Fetterman’s message is a demand for a US federal decision, while Switzerland’s St. Gallen project is a measured local experiment. The contrast shows why rescheduling, descheduling and regulated pilot access should not be treated as interchangeable forms of reform.
